Output 14ae064a2c99575a112983d317c8cd3fa935471aff55d0861d4ec0d1f3312f02:6

value
38620023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d1377e755c76aacddf89229321521eb82ae3d7 OP_EQUAL
address
3EXbA34GGFKUX7gEBwGnZcxfyKYo4gVuBb
transaction
14ae064a2c99575a112983d317c8cd3fa935471aff55d0861d4ec0d1f3312f02
spent
true